发明名称 Time coding device for measurement of physical magnitude - splits light source beam into beams having different wavelengths, one beam being coded and another acting as trigger for detector
摘要 The time coding device uses a source (1) of luminous pulses and a coding unit (2) whose position depends on the value of the physical magnitude. A detector (4) transmits (5) the light pulses towards the coding unit (2) and a pulse receiver for the coded pulses. The source (1) simultaneously generates pulses with two different wavelengths, lambda 1 and lambda 2. The light pulses are separated (9a) as a function of their wavelength. The pulses with a wavelength lambda 1 pass through the detector (4) and are coded. The pulses with wavelength lambda 2 are redirected to an analyser (7) to act as pulses for triggering the detector (4). USE/ADVANTAGE- Fibre optic position detector for aircraft or work machine. Precise triggering of detector acquisition while avoiding any risk of error.
